> As I think they are in DER format so I use
> openssl x509 -inform DER -in xxxxxx.cer -noout -text

I was able to get it to output the characters correctly by adding
"-nameopt multiline,utf8,-esc_msb" to the command-line.

It makes me wonder though why isn't UTF-8 the default output on a
Linux system with LANG set to "en_US.UTF-8"?
